International SIM Card from India | WorldSIM | USA SIM Card | Europe SIM Card | Global SIM Card | Seafarer SIM Card from India | International Roaming SIM Card Mumbai Delhi Bangalore Chennai Pune Ahmedabad Kolkata Buy International Roaming SIM Card online shopping in India
Category: Consumer Electronics
Country: India (IN)
Platform: WooCommerce
Technologies used: Google Adsense, Google Analytics, Google Tag Manager, Yoast
Contact page: https://planetroam.in/contact
Signup for Free. No Credit Card required.Suitable for marketing agencies, app developers and new business ideas.
No credit card required.